Job Description:

Executes operational activities related to quote, price, configuration, deal registration, order management process, invoicing, and contract life-cycle management to ensure that sales orders are successfully completed from quote to delivery and credited appropriately assigned for sales compensation. Produces deal documentation and configures systems to reflect ordering processes. Generates invoices and client billing in accordance with service and product agreements. Records, updates and validates customer and deal information in systems produces reports and analyses of sales processing activities.

Job Responsibility:

  • Supports sales processing activities for assigned areas and processes
  • Learns requirements and develops capability in all areas of sales processing
  • Collects, consolidates, and charts data from sales and process results for assigned portions of operations areas to identify trends and issues
  • learns and practices basic analysis
  • Implements specified changes to processes and tools to improve performance, efficiency and customer satisfaction
  • Develops understanding of internal and external relationships with stakeholders for performance expectations and needs

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ree in Business Management or equivalent
  • Typically 0-2 years experience
  • Basic understanding of business and sales processing tools, systems and practices
  • Good analytical, statistics and problem solving skills
  • Good written and verbal communication skills
  • mastery in English and local language
